https://api.sandbase.ai/v1/runstability-ai/sdxl-controlnet-union/inpaintingInput Schema
21 parameters · 2 required · 19 optional
| Parameter | Type | Required | Description |
|---|---|---|---|
image | string | Required | The URL of the image to use as a starting point for the generation. |
prompt | string | Required | The prompt to use for generating the image. Be as descriptive as possible for best results. |
mask | string | Optional | The URL of the mask to use for inpainting. |
seed | integer | Optional | The same seed and the same prompt given to the same version of Stable Diffusion will output the same image every time. · Default: null |
loras | array | Optional | Default: [] |
strength | number | Optional | determines how much the generated image resembles the initial image · Min: 0.01 · Max: 1 · Default: 0.95 |
aspect_ratio | string | Optional | The aspect ratio of the generated image. · Options: 21:9, 16:9, 3:2, 4:3, 5:4, 1:1, 4:5, 3:4, 2:3, 9:16 21:916:93:24:35:41:14:53:42:39:16 |
guidance_scale | number | Optional | Min: 0 · Max: 20 · Default: 7.5 |
teed_image_url | string | Optional | The URL of the control image. · Default: null |
canny_image_url | string | Optional | The URL of the control image. · Default: null |
depth_image_url | string | Optional | The URL of the control image. · Default: null |
teed_preprocess | boolean | Optional | Whether to preprocess the teed image. · Default: true |
canny_preprocess | boolean | Optional | Whether to preprocess the canny image. · Default: true |
depth_preprocess | boolean | Optional | Whether to preprocess the depth image. · Default: true |
normal_image_url | string | Optional | The URL of the control image. · Default: null |
normal_preprocess | boolean | Optional | Whether to preprocess the normal image. · Default: true |
openpose_image_url | string | Optional | The URL of the control image. · Default: null |
num_inference_steps | integer | Optional | Min: 1 · Max: 70 · Default: 35 |
openpose_preprocess | boolean | Optional | Whether to preprocess the openpose image. · Default: true |
segmentation_image_url | string | Optional | The URL of the control image. · Default: null |
segmentation_preprocess | boolean | Optional | Whether to preprocess the segmentation image. · Default: true |

Async Workflow
This model uses asynchronous execution. Submit a request and poll for the result.
- Submit — POST to /v1/run, receive an
id - Poll — GET /v1/run/{id} until status is
completed,failed, ortimeout - Retrieve — Read
outputsfrom the completed response
